The End of the Anonymity Myth

One of the most persistent misconceptions in international company formation is that appointing a nominee director can conceal ownership or remove regulatory disclosure obligations.

Modern UK company law takes a different approach.

Companies are required to identify and maintain information regarding their Persons with Significant Control (PSCs), ensuring that individuals who ultimately own or exercise significant influence over a company can be identified through the appropriate regulatory framework.

In practice:

  • Directors manage the company.
  • PSCs identify ownership and control.
  • Company Secretaries support administration and compliance.

Director appointments do not replace ownership transparency obligations.

Every Director Has Real Legal Responsibilities

The Companies House register does not distinguish between "active" and "passive" directors.

Every person appointed as a company director assumes statutory responsibilities under the Companies Act 2006, including duties relating to:

  • Corporate governance
  • Fiduciary responsibilities
  • Compliance oversight
  • Acting in the company's best interests

Whether described as a:


the legal obligations remain fundamentally the same.

Professional director appointments therefore require appropriate identity verification, governance procedures, and documented authority structures.

Identity Verification and Director Appointments

The UK is moving towards a more robust identity verification framework for directors and other corporate participants.

Verified individuals are increasingly expected to demonstrate their identity through approved verification processes, helping strengthen trust in the Companies House register and reduce corporate misuse.

For businesses operating internationally, this means governance structures should be designed around transparency, verification, and compliance rather than anonymity.

Resident Directors, Management and Substance

Business owners should understand that appointing a UK Resident Director alone does not automatically determine:

  • Tax residency
  • Central Management and Control
  • Economic Substance

These matters depend on the broader facts and circumstances of how a company operates.

However, an actively engaged resident director who participates in governance, strategic review, and board decision-making may contribute positively to a company’s overall management framework and UK presence.

The End of Corporate Anonymity

One of the most common misconceptions among international founders is that appointing a nominee director removes the need for ownership disclosure.

It does not.

UK transparency requirements require companies to maintain accurate records of:

  • Directors
  • Shareholders
  • Persons with Significant Control (PSCs)
  • Relevant Legal Entities (RLEs), where applicable

Individuals who meet the statutory thresholds for significant ownership or control must generally be disclosed through the appropriate reporting framework.

Modern compliance systems increasingly focus on identifying the individuals who ultimately control or benefit from a company rather than simply reviewing the names appearing on the board.

Director Appointments Now Require Greater Verification

Board appointments are subject to increasing levels of scrutiny.

Companies must ensure that director information is accurate, up to date, and compliant with current filing requirements.

Identity verification obligations introduced under recent reforms have increased the importance of ensuring that company officers are properly documented before appointments and filings are submitted.

This has significantly reduced the viability of informal or poorly managed director arrangements.

UK Company Formation: Resident Director Support vs Registered Office Services

When launching a UK private limited company, establishing the right governance and business infrastructure is just as important as completing the incorporation itself. For startups, international entrepreneurs, and expanding businesses, understanding the difference between UK resident director support and registered office services can help you build a stronger foundation for growth.

A UK Resident Director service provides access to a UK-based director who assumes the statutory duties and responsibilities required under the Companies Act 2006. Subject to due diligence and appointment procedures, a resident director may help support communication with Companies House, financial institutions, payment providers, and commercial partners, while contributing to a stronger UK operational presence and governance framework.

A Registered Office service, by contrast, provides your company's official address for statutory and government correspondence. This address appears on the public register and helps ensure that important notices, compliance reminders, and legal documents are received and managed efficiently. For many businesses, a prestigious London address can also enhance their professional image and credibility.

These services are often complementary rather than alternatives. A resident director can support governance and administration, while a registered office provides the infrastructure required to manage official correspondence and maintain a professional UK presence.

Frequently Asked Questions

Can a virtual office act as a company director?
No. A virtual office provides address and communication services only. It does not perform governance or director functions.

Do I need a UK resident director to form a UK company?
Most UK private limited companies can be incorporated without a UK resident director. However, some businesses choose to appoint one for governance, local representation, or operational support.

Can I use both a virtual office and a resident director?
Yes. Many international businesses use both services as part of a broader corporate governance and compliance strategy.

Is a virtual office the same as a registered office?
No. While the same address may sometimes be used, registered office services and virtual office services are distinct offerings with different purposes.

What Is an ACSP?

An Authorised Corporate Service Provider (ACSP) is a business that has been authorised to carry out specific Companies House services, including identity verification and certain filings on behalf of clients.

ACSPs operate within a regulated compliance framework designed to improve the accuracy and integrity of information submitted to Companies House.

Many modern formation agents, accountants, solicitors, and corporate service providers now operate as ACSPs.

    Frequently Asked Questions

    What is an ACSP?
    An Authorised Corporate Service Provider (ACSP) is a business authorised to perform specific Companies House services, including identity verification and certain filings on behalf of clients.

    Do I need an ACSP to form a company?
    Not necessarily. However, many businesses choose an ACSP-based provider because of the additional compliance and verification support available.

    Are traditional formation agents still relevant?
    Yes. Many traditional formation agents continue to provide valuable company formation services, and many have also become ACSPs.

    Is an ACSP the same as a company formation agent?
    Not exactly. An ACSP is a regulatory status, while a formation agent is a service provider. Some formation agents are ACSPs, while others are not.

    What additional services do ACSP providers offer?
    Many offer identity verification, company secretarial support, registered office services, PSC administration, and ongoing compliance assistance.

    ACSP Explained: Why Every Legitimate UK Company Formation Provider Must Be Authorised

    The Most Common Misunderstanding About ACSPs
    One of the biggest misconceptions in the modern UK company formation market is the belief that an Authorised Corporate Service Provider (ACSP) is a specialist type of technology platform or automated incorporation service.

    It is not.

    Under the Economic Crime and Corporate Transparency Act (ECCTA), an ACSP is a regulatory designation granted to eligible professional intermediaries that are authorised to carry out identity verification and submit filings through approved Companies House channels.

    An ACSP may be:

    • A company formation agent
    • An accountancy practice
    • A law firm
    • A corporate services provider
    • A governance consultancy
    • A specialist compliance provider

    The defining feature is not technology. The defining feature is authorisation.

    Why ACSP Status Matters

    The UK has introduced significant reforms designed to improve the accuracy, reliability, and transparency of information held on the public register.

    As part of these reforms, professional intermediaries involved in company formations and corporate filings must operate within an authorised framework.

    To become an ACSP, a provider must generally:

    • Be supervised by a recognised UK Anti-Money Laundering (AML) supervisory body
    • Meet Companies House registration requirements
    • Maintain appropriate compliance procedures
    • Conduct required identity verification checks
    • Retain supporting records where required by law

    This creates greater accountability throughout the company formation process.
